BUILDING GREEN, presented by the Atlantic Chapter of the Canada Green Building Council in partnership with the Nova Scotia Community College, is a day long (Friday May 16th) conference, trade show and networking event that will explore the design, construction and operation of green buildings.
Speakers include local and national experts in the field of sustainable communities, buildings and materials, featuring John Kokko, a consultant on the Okatoks Alberta sustainable community project; Sheila Brown of Jacques Whitford, renowned LEED faculty member; Joan MacAurthur-Blair, president of NSCC; Stephen King, HRM's "Green Crusader," and more.
The trade show provides a marketing opportunity for suppliers of green building materials, technologies and services. Delegates will have both lunch and a wine & cheese reception at the trade show.
All profits from Building Green will be used to provide assistance to NSCC students in the building technologies programs.
